How to file for SSDI in Oklahoma?

Applying for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) in Oklahoma can be a detailed process, and knowing the correct steps helps improve your chances of success. Whether you’re applying for the first time or after a recent disability, following the right procedures ensures your application is complete and ready for review.

1. Gather Required Information

Before starting your SSDI application, make sure you have:


  • Social Security number and birth certificate
  • Proof of U.S. citizenship or legal residency
  • Detailed medical records and doctors’ contact information
  • Work history for the past 15 years, including job duties
  • Recent tax returns or W-2 forms


Having all documents ready can prevent delays.


2. Choose Your Filing Method

You can file your SSDI application in Oklahoma through:


  • Online: Apply at ssa.gov for convenience
  • Phone: Call 1-800-772-1213 (TTY 1-800-325-0778) to apply with an SSA representative
  • In Person: Visit your nearest Oklahoma Social Security office to apply directly


3. Complete the Disability Report

The Disability Report asks for:


  • Medical conditions and treatment details
  • All doctors, hospitals, and clinics visited
  • Medications you take and side effects
  • Any work changes caused by your condition


Be thorough and truthful to avoid errors that could delay your claim.


4. Submit Your Application

Once all information is filled in, submit your SSDI application through your chosen method. You’ll get a confirmation number—keep this for tracking purposes.


5. Respond to SSA Requests Quickly

The SSA may ask for additional medical records, forms, or a consultative exam. Responding promptly keeps your case moving forward.


6. Wait for a Decision

SSDI claims in Oklahoma often take 3–6 months for an initial decision. In the meantime, you can track your application through your my Social Security account online.
